Jana Jackson (Republican Party) ran for election to the Arizona House of Representatives to represent District 4. She lost in the Republican primary on August 2, 2022.
Jackson also ran for election to the U.S. House to represent Arizona's 9th Congressional District. She did not appear on the ballot for the Republican primary on August 2, 2022.

State House
See also: Arizona House of Representatives elections, 2022
General election
General election for Arizona House of Representatives District 4 (2 seats)
Matt Gress and Laura Terech defeated Maria Syms in the general election for Arizona House of Representatives District 4 on November 8, 2022.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
| ✔ | Matt Gress (R) | 34.7 | 61,527 | |
| ✔ | Laura Terech (D) | 33.5 | 59,292 | |
| Maria Syms (R) | 31.8 | 56,383 | ||
| Total votes: 177,202 | ||||

Republican primary election
Republican primary for Arizona House of Representatives District 4 (2 seats)
The following candidates ran in the Republican primary for Arizona House of Representatives District 4 on August 2, 2022.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
| ✔ | Maria Syms | 25.7 | 16,417 | |
| ✔ | Matt Gress | 24.9 | 15,878 | |
| Vera Gebran | 18.1 | 11,567 | ||
| John Arnold | 15.1 | 9,610 | ||
| Jana Jackson | 8.6 | 5,507 | ||
| Kenneth Bowers | 7.6 | 4,825 | ||
| Total votes: 63,804 | ||||

2020
See also: Arizona House of Representatives elections, 2020
General election
General election for Arizona House of Representatives District 28 (2 seats)
Incumbent Kelli Butler and incumbent Aaron Lieberman defeated Jana Jackson and Kenneth Bowers in the general election for Arizona House of Representatives District 28 on November 3, 2020.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
| ✔ | Kelli Butler (D) | 27.6 | 60,871 | |
| ✔ | Aaron Lieberman (D) | 26.2 | 57,760 | |
| Jana Jackson (R) | 23.9 | 52,839 | ||
| Kenneth Bowers (R) | 22.3 | 49,306 | ||
| Total votes: 220,776 | ||||
